Office Building Water Extraction Cost in Sandy, UT

The cost of office building water extraction in Sandy, UT can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on typical prices and may vary depending on your specific situation. Call us now for a free estimate and to discuss your options.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Containment and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and drying time.
Cleaning and Disinfecting $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and cleaning time.
Moisture Testing and Inspections $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ed.
Document Drying and Preservation $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of documents, and drying time.
Emergency Response and Service $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and equipment needed.

Q: How do I prevent office building water damage?

A: To prevent office building water damage, make sure to regularly inspect your plumbing, appliances, and roof for signs of wear and tear. Also, keep an eye out for signs of water damage, such as warping or buckling flooring, and address them quickly. Regular maintenance can help prevent costly repairs.
